RLX Technology Inc

RLX Technology trades at $2.02, up 2.02% on the day, with a bullish technical signal from moving averages. The company reported strong 2025 fundamentals with $3.62B revenue, $922M net income, and robust cash flow from operations of $1.10B. Recent Q1 2026 results showed revenue growth driven by international expansion, though EPS missed expectations for three consecutive quarters. The stock carries a P/E of 18.37 and P/S of 3.82, with no debt and significant cash reserves.

Outlook remains mixed with strong industry growth potential in vaping (projected to reach $462B by 2033) offset by recent earnings misses and a single analyst maintaining a Hold rating. Key risks include regulatory scrutiny in China and abroad, competitive pressures, and execution on international expansion. The company's debt-free balance sheet and cash-rich position provide financial flexibility amid these challenges.

About iShares MSCI Australia ETF

EWA tracks the MSCI Australia Index, providing broad exposure to large and mid-cap companies in the Australian equity market. It is structurally dominated by the financial and materials sectors, serving as a key instrument for investors seeking a single-country view of Australia's resource-rich and stable economy.

About RLX Technology Inc

RLX Technology Inc. is a leading e-vapor company in China, focusing on the research, development, and sale of e-vapor products. The company primarily operates under the RELX brand, offering a range of closed-system e-vapor products designed to deliver a high-quality user experience. RLX's business model is centered on product innovation, strong brand building, and a vast distribution network across China.
